Job Summary
We are seeking a compassionate and motivated Registered Nurse (RN) to join our Assertive Community Treatment (ACT) team, providing community-based psychiatric nursing services to individuals with serious mental illness. Responsibilities include administering medications, conducting health assessments, collaborating with a multidisciplinary team, assisting with crisis intervention, and educating clients and families on health management. Candidates must have an active RN license in New Mexico and ideally possess behavioral health nursing experience.
